Typically, smart wheels use two or three contacts on the wheel that leads to a multiplexing unit.  The switches have their own "tone" (like a telephone).  When you push one of the buttons on the steering wheel, the switch transmits its' distinct frequency to the multiplexing unit that figures out which frequency it is and directs it to whatever needs to turn on.  Without the multiplexing unit, the smartwheel will just be a dumb wheel with a bunch of switches on it.  Good Luck, TomC
